The size of Peeramon is approximately 28.3 square kilometres. There is 1 park within the area. The population of Peeramon in 2016 was 628 people. By 2021 the population was 778 showing a population growth of 23.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Peeramon is 50-59 years. Households in Peeramon are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Peeramon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 83.90% of the homes in Peeramon were owner-occupied compared with 85.80% in 2016.
